Davido’s Father Offers Employment To First-Class Graduates

Nigerian billionaire and founder of Adeleke University, Dr. Adedeji Adeleke has promised his support for the institution’s first-class engineering graduates.

During his speech at the university’s 10th undergraduate and 6th postgraduate convocations, Adeleke made the announcement.

Adeleke, the group chairman of Pacific Energy Company, said that all first-class engineering students are invited to participate in the National Youth Service Corps program by working at the Pacific Energy plant’s branches in Ogun State or Ondo State.

Adeleke also promised these graduates that they would be hired automatically after their service year ended.

He said, “Try as much as possible to get NYSC to post you to either Ogun State or Ondo State, where we have our power plant. You are welcome to serve at the plant, and after your service year, you have an automatic job.”
